Discontinued for 2011 parts:

FR500 steering wheels are discontinued and gone
FGT wet sump blocks are gone, dry sump "while quantities last".
Aluminator SC bare blocks are gone
Aluminator NA bare blocks are no longer listed
FGT heads are gone, replaced by Shelby heads
Cobra brake calipers GONE
Fox body ft. LCA's GONE
Axle shafts (all from 79-04) GONE

Quote:
Originally Posted by txmach302 View Post
on the alum driveshaft that works for out stock 3650 when i get a built 3650, will the same driveshaft work? i know i have to change clutch and flywheel but didn't know on this, thanks

ASh
Unless you are changing from a 10 spline input shaft to a 26,
no need to change the clutch.
If you ARE changing to a 26 spline input shaft,
FRPP has a clutch for that.
M-7560-T46

"Kit contains 11" clutch disc with 26 spline hub and pressure plate.
Clutch disc with carbon/copper lining on flywheel side and carbon lining on pressure plate side.
Centrifugal assist design pressure plate with 25% more torque capacity then production Cobra.
Used when installing M-7003-R58C and M-7003-R58H transmissions into 1996-04 4.6L Mustangs
with production 11" flywheel or Ford Racing flywheels M-6375-F46, M-6375-G46 or M-6375-R00."
